16 /**
17  * struct dpu_rm - DPU dynamic hardware resource manager
18  * @pingpong_blks: array of pingpong hardware resources
19  * @mixer_blks: array of layer mixer hardware resources
20  * @ctl_blks: array of ctl hardware resources
21  * @hw_intf: array of intf hardware resources
22  * @hw_wb: array of wb hardware resources
23  * @hw_cwb: array of cwb hardware resources
24  * @dspp_blks: array of dspp hardware resources
25  * @hw_sspp: array of sspp hardware resources
26  * @cdm_blk: cdm hardware resource
27  * @has_legacy_ctls: DPU uses pre-ACTIVE CTL blocks.
28  */
29 struct dpu_rm {
30 	struct dpu_hw_blk *pingpong_blks[PINGPONG_MAX - PINGPONG_0];
31 	struct dpu_hw_blk *mixer_blks[LM_MAX - LM_0];
32 	struct dpu_hw_blk *ctl_blks[CTL_MAX - CTL_0];
33 	struct dpu_hw_intf *hw_intf[INTF_MAX - INTF_0];
34 	struct dpu_hw_wb *hw_wb[WB_MAX - WB_0];
35 	struct dpu_hw_blk *cwb_blks[CWB_MAX - CWB_0];
36 	struct dpu_hw_blk *dspp_blks[DSPP_MAX - DSPP_0];
37 	struct dpu_hw_blk *merge_3d_blks[MERGE_3D_MAX - MERGE_3D_0];
38 	struct dpu_hw_blk *dsc_blks[DSC_MAX - DSC_0];
39 	struct dpu_hw_sspp *hw_sspp[SSPP_MAX - SSPP_NONE];
40 	struct dpu_hw_blk *cdm_blk;
41 	bool has_legacy_ctls;
42 };
43 
44 struct dpu_rm_sspp_requirements {
45 	bool yuv;
46 	bool scale;
47 	bool rot90;
48 };
49 
50 /**
51  * struct msm_display_topology - defines a display topology pipeline
52  * @num_lm:       number of layer mixers used
53  * @num_intf:     number of interfaces the panel is mounted on
54  * @num_dspp:     number of dspp blocks used
55  * @num_dsc:      number of Display Stream Compression (DSC) blocks used
56  * @num_cdm:      indicates how many outputs are requesting cdm block for
57  *                    this display topology
58  * @cwb_enabled:  indicates whether CWB is enabled for this display topology
59  */
60 struct msm_display_topology {
61 	u32 num_lm;
62 	u32 num_intf;
63 	u32 num_dspp;
64 	u32 num_dsc;
65 	int num_cdm;
66 	bool cwb_enabled;
67 };
